activity 1
1. explain why increasing extracellular k+ reduces the net diffusion of k+ out of the neuron through the k+ leak channels.
2.explain why increasing extracellular k+ causes the membrane potential to change to a less negative value.


Title: Re: Need help with Neurophysiology of nerve impulses from physioex 9.0
Post by: Hipopalamus on Sep 6, 2013
Question #1
- as the concentration gradient outside increases, the concentration of K+ outside the cell opposes the flow of K+ through the leak channels.
